Behavioral Changes: Aggression, Withdrawal, or Inappropriate Actions
Many children in care may exhibit behavioral changes when they’re experiencing neglect, especially if it’s happening within their trusted environment like a daycare facility. A significant red flag is a sudden shift in behavior that can manifest as aggression towards peers or staff. This could be an unusual level of irritability, tantrums, or even physical violence—behaviors not typically associated with your child’s temperament.
Withdrawal from social interactions and activities is another sign to watch for. If your usually outgoing child becomes more secluded, reluctant to participate in group play, or loses interest in their favorite pastimes, it might indicate they’re feeling unsafe or neglected. In extreme cases, children may display inappropriate actions, such as behaving in a way that’s significantly older or younger than their age, a potential coping mechanism for the trauma they’re experiencing. Physical Signs of Abuse and Neglect
Neglect in a care facility can leave visible and invisible marks on a child, both physically and emotionally. While some signs might be easier to identify than others, it’s crucial for parents and caregivers to be vigilant. Common physical indicators of abuse or neglect include unexplained bruises, cuts, welts, or rashes. These could suggest physical violence or lack of proper care, especially if accompanied by uncleanliness or poor hygiene.
Moreover, a child experiencing neglect may exhibit unusual behavior such as withdrawal, aggression, or extreme fearfulness. Changes in appetite and sleep patterns can also be red flags. In cases of severe neglect, children might struggle with developmental milestones, display stunted growth, or have consistent issues with their overall health. Unusual Stories or Inconsistencies in Their Narrative
If your child’s stories or explanations for their experiences seem unusual, it could be a red flag. Children who are experiencing neglect or have been subjected to traumatic events may display inconsistencies in their narratives due to fear, confusion, or attempts to protect themselves. For instance, they might skip over details of an incident, change their story over time, or make up events that never occurred. Lack of Basic Needs Fulfillment
In any care setting, be it a daycare or foster facility, the fulfillment of basic needs is paramount. When these needs are consistently unmet, it could be an alarming sign that something is amiss. Children who are experiencing neglect may exhibit noticeable changes in their physical and emotional well-being. For instance, a child might appear malnourished, have frequent health issues like untreated wounds or infections, or show signs of inadequate hygiene. These basic needs often include proper nourishment, clean clothing, access to safe drinking water, and adequate sleep—all fundamental for a child’s healthy development.
Neglect can also manifest in the form of emotional and social deprivation. If a child seems detached, displays extreme mood swings, or shows no interest in activities they previously enjoyed, it could indicate that their emotional needs are not being met. Secretiveness and Fear of Certain Places or People
Secretiveness and fear can be significant red flags indicating that a child may be experiencing neglect, especially within a daycare or care facility environment. If your child suddenly becomes secretive about their daily activities, refusing to share details about their time at school, it could suggest they are being subjected to distressing situations. They might avoid discussing certain people or places, indicating discomfort or fear associated with specific individuals or scenarios.
This behavior shift could be a sign of emotional or even physical abuse, including potential daycare sexual assault cases. It’s crucial to encourage open communication and create a safe space for children to express their feelings without judgment.
